Folding mirrors
I have just discovered my roc has electric folding mirrors, just wondering, this may have been covered elsewhere but too many people go off topic haha ; my question is , is there a setting the make the mirrors fold in when you lock the car on the fob and open when you unlock it ? Because I can only seem the electrically fold them in by manually flicking the switch on the mirror control, thanks, Rob

Re: Folding mirrors
No automatic setting, they needed to be folded / unfolded manually.

Sorry to drag this one up! Apparantly this missing feature has been included on the Golf VII..... however talking to a dealer today and going out to try this feature on a Mk.VII GTD we could not get it to work - its just the same system as in the Roc with the control of the mirror folding by the control knob on the door. Anybody with a GTD care to comment - is it something that has to be set up using the MFD computer?
UPDATE - Yes it is a feature! - but one that has to be activated in the system set up on the Mk.VII Golf (obviously the dealers car did not have the box ticked!).
